Ubuntu22.04中文输入法

Ubuntu22.04中文输入法

在Ubuntu中如果没有中文输入法,注释是很不方便的

在添加中文输入法的过程中参考了一些博客,发现22.04版本的Ubuntu的输入法设置和之前版本的有所不同,所以打算写一篇博客给使用最新版Ubuntu的小伙伴参考。

step1:下载fcitx


在终端输入:

sudo apt-update
sudo apt-get install fcitx-bin

安装过程截图在这里插入图片描述
后面会让你确认Y/n:输入y就可以

step2:下载安装了fictx之后,在设置的区域与语言中,点击“管理已安装的语言”

step3:​​在弹出的窗口中,把键盘输入法系统改成Fcitx 4

​​

step4:在设置的键盘中,点击输入源中的+,引入中文智能拼音

​​​

step5:虚拟机页面右上角出现输入法图标,点击切换即可

在这里插入图片描述

<think>嗯,用户现在问的是在Ubuntu 22.04上设置中文输入法。之前他们遇到了CMake的错误,现在转向了另一个问题,可能是在配置开发环境时需要用到中文输入。我要先理清Ubuntu下常用的中文输入法有哪些,然后逐步介绍安装步骤。 首先,用户可能对Linux环境不太熟悉,所以需要步骤清晰。Ubuntu 22.04默认可能没有安装中文输入法,特别是对于新安装的系统。常见的输入法有IBus、Fcitx,这两种都是常用的框架。IBus可能更集成在GNOME桌面环境中,而Fcitx支持更多插件,比如搜狗输入法。 我需要先确认用户是否需要安装输入法框架,比如IBus或Fcitx,然后安装对应的中文引擎,比如拼音。然后可能需要配置语言支持,添加中文,最后设置输入法快捷键。 要注意的是,用户可能在安装过程中遇到依赖问题,或者配置后无法正常切换输入法,需要给出常见问题的解决方法,比如重启、检查配置、安装缺失的包等。 另外,用户可能想使用第三方输入法,比如搜狗拼音,但需要知道Ubuntu 22.04是否支持,因为之前版本可能会有兼容性问题。可能需要添加PPA源或者下载deb包手动安装,同时处理可能的依赖冲突。 还要提醒用户在安装完成后可能需要注销或重启系统,或者手动启动输入法服务。另外,输入法配置工具的位置和如何切换输入法也是关键点,比如在设置中找到区域与语言,添加输入源,或者使用im-config配置默认输入法框架。 总结一下,回答的结构应该是先介绍常用输入法,然后分步骤安装IBus或Fcitx,包括安装引擎,配置语言支持,设置输入法,最后处理常见问题和推荐第三方输入法。需要确保步骤详细,命令准确,特别是针对Ubuntu 22.04的包管理命令,比如使用apt安装ibus、fcitx等包。</think>在 Ubuntu 22.04 上设置中文输入法通常需要安装输入法框架(如 **IBus** 或 **Fcitx**)并配置中文输入引擎(如拼音、五笔等)。以下是详细的步骤指南: --- ### **1. 安装中文语言支持** 1. **打开系统设置** 进入 `Settings` → `Region & Language` → `Manage Installed Languages`。 2. **安装语言包** 如果中文未安装,点击 `Install/Remove Languages`,勾选 **Chinese (Simplified)**,点击 `Apply` 安装语言包。 3. **设置默认语言** 将中文拖动到语言列表顶部,重启系统以生效。 --- ### **2. 选择输入法框架** #### **选项一:使用 IBus(默认集成)** 1. **安装 IBus 和中文输入引擎** ```bash sudo apt install ibus ibus-libpinyin ibus-pinyin ``` - `ibus-libpinyin`: 智能拼音输入法(推荐) - `ibus-pinyin`: 传统拼音输入法 2. **配置 IBus** - 打开 `Settings` → `Keyboard` → `Input Sources` → `+`,添加 `Chinese (China)` → `Chinese (Intelligent Pinyin)`。 - 通过 `Super` (Windows) 键 + `空格` 切换输入法。 3. **重启 IBus 服务(可选)** ```bash ibus restart ``` --- #### **选项二:使用 Fcitx(支持更多第三方输入法)** 1. **安装 Fcitx 框架** ```bash sudo apt install fcitx fcitx-libpinyin fcitx-config-gtk ``` 2. **切换输入法框架** ```bash im-config -n fcitx # 选择 Fcitx 为默认框架 ``` 3. **安装中文输入法引擎** ```bash sudo apt install fcitx-sunpinyin # 其他引擎可选:fcitx-googlepinyin ``` 4. **配置 Fcitx** - 打开 `Fcitx Configuration`(从应用菜单启动)。 - 点击 `+` 添加输入法,取消勾选 `Only Show Current Language`,搜索并添加 `Pinyin` 或 `LibPinyin`。 5. **重启系统或输入法服务** ```bash fcitx -r # 重启 Fcitx ``` --- ### **3. 安装第三方输入法(如搜狗拼音)** 1. **添加搜狗输入法仓库** ```bash sudo apt install wget gdebi-core wget http://archive.ubuntukylin.com/software/pool/partner/sogoupinyin_4.2.1.145_amd64.deb sudo gdebi sogoupinyin_4.2.1.145_amd64.deb # 安装 deb 包 ``` 2. **解决依赖冲突(若安装失败)** ```bash sudo apt --fix-broken install # 自动修复依赖 ``` 3. **配置 Fcitx** - 在 `Fcitx Configuration` 中添加 `Sogou Pinyin`。 --- ### **4. 常见问题解决** - **输入法无法切换** - 检查输入法框架是否生效:运行 `im-config` 确认已选择 `ibus` 或 `fcitx`。 -r`。 - **候选词框不显示** 安装缺失的依赖库: ```bash sudo apt install libopencc5 libqt5qml5 libqt5quick5 # 搜狗输入法常见依赖 ``` - **托盘图标消失** 手动启动输入法框架: ```bash ibus-daemon -drx # 启动 IBus fcitx -d # 启动 Fcitx ``` --- ### **总结** - **推荐新手使用 IBus + 智能拼音**,简单稳定。 - **需要第三方输入法(如搜狗)选择 Fcitx**,但需注意兼容性问题。 - 通过 `Super + 空格` 或自定义快捷键切换输入法
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

^_^2412

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值